Discover the secret behind show-stopping painterly quilts: “Invaluable advice on creating successful compositions.” —Machine Quilting Unlimited
 
Grace Errea and Meridith Osterfeld share their art quilting expertise by demonstrating the impact of value on a quilt—it creates a focal point, develops dimensionality, changes a mood, and creates a painterly effect.
 
Explore the unexpected and making your quilt becomes a dreamlike experience in which the sea ebbs and flows in shades of fire, and feathered creatures evoke cotton candy softness. Impressionist Appliqué includes links to full-size patterns for five projects and features three appliqué techniques: turned-edge, raw-edge, and free-edge.

About the Author

Grace Errea is a fiber artist whose innovative techniques and nature settings have attracted widespread interest in the quilt world, as well as from galleries and museums. She lives in Southern California.

Meridith Osterfeld is an art quilter, a photographer, and writer-these passions inspire her to explore the creative world outside the box.'' She lives in Southern California.
